IT Systems Analyst - Network Engineer

CoxHealthSpringfield, MO
Onsite

About The Position

The IT Systems Analyst is responsible for designing, testing, implementing, and troubleshooting IT applications and for ensuring the availability, stability, and reliability of those applications. They monitor system performance, identify, and resolve technical issues, and ensure efficient operation of all clinical systems. The analyst also provides technical support to end-users and collaborates with other IT teams to resolve complex technical problems related to clinical systems. CoxHealth is a leading healthcare system serving 25 counties across southwest Missouri and northern Arkansas. The organization includes six hospitals, 5 ERs, and over 80 clinics. CoxHealth has earned numerous honors for workplace excellence, including being named one of Modern Healthcare’s Best Places to work five times, and recognized by Newsweek and Forbes for various workplace achievements.

Responsibilities

  • Designing, testing, implementing, and troubleshooting IT applications.
  • Ensuring the availability, stability, and reliability of applications.
  • Monitoring system performance.
  • Identifying and resolving technical issues.
  • Ensuring efficient operation of all clinical systems.
  • Providing technical support to end-users.
  • Collaborating with other IT teams to resolve complex technical problems related to clinical systems.
  • Configuring Devices: Routers, switches, firewalls, load balancers, and wireless controllers.
  • Troubleshooting using tools like Ping, traceroute, Wireshark, NetFlow, SNMP monitoring.
  • Working with Cabling & Hardware: Fiber, copper, transceivers, patch panels, rack/stack.
  • Understanding and applying Networking Fundamentals: TCP/IP, OSI model, subnetting, VLANs, routing vs. switching, DNS, DHCP, NAT.
  • Working with Protocols & Services: HTTP/S, FTP, SMTP, SNMP, VPNs, VoIP, multicast.
  • Utilizing LAN/WAN Technologies: Ethernet, wireless standards (802.11), MPLS, SD-WAN.
  • Implementing Routing & Switching: Static and dynamic routing (OSPF, BGP), STP, port channels, trunking.
